| Roman Bronze of muscular Orpheus, son of Apollo, inventor of the Lyre and chief poet and musician of antiquity, depicted nude and seated in wilderness he charms wild beasts including a turtle, goat, two serpents, salamander, and snail. Circa 1st - 3rd Century C.E. Bronze is 3 3/4" high and on custom lucite stand height is 5 3/4". Loss to both arms but in excellent condition. | ||||||
